Рассчитать проценты назначения ресурсов с помощью Aspose.Tasks
Введение
В управлении проектами точный расчет распределения ресурсов имеет решающее значение для обеспечения своевременного выполнения задач и эффективного распределения ресурсов. Aspose.Tasks for Java предоставляет мощные инструменты для облегчения этого процесса, позволяя разработчикам с легкостью рассчитывать проценты для назначения ресурсов.
Предварительные условия
Прежде чем погрузиться в расчет процентов для назначения ресурсов с помощью Aspose.Tasks для Java, убедитесь, что у вас есть следующее:
Среда разработки Java
Убедитесь, что в вашей системе установлен Java Development Kit (JDK). Вы можете скачать его сздесь.
Aspose.Tasks для библиотеки Java
Загрузите и установите библиотеку Aspose.Tasks для Java. Вы можете найти ссылку для скачиванияздесь.
Интегрированная среда разработки (IDE)
Выберите для кодирования предпочитаемую среду IDE, например IntelliJ IDEA, Eclipse или NetBeans.
Импортировать пакеты
Для начала импортируйте необходимые пакеты в свой Java-код:
import com.aspose.tasks.Asn;
import com.aspose.tasks.Project;
import com.aspose.tasks.ResourceAssignment;
Шаг 1. Настройте каталог данных
Убедитесь, что у вас есть назначенный каталог, в котором находятся данные вашего проекта. Вы будете использовать этот каталог для доступа к файлам вашего проекта.
String dataDir = "Your Data Directory";
Шаг 2. Загрузите файл проекта.
Создать экземплярProject
объект и загрузите файл проекта, используя указанный каталог данных.
Project project = new Project(dataDir + "ResourceAssignmentVariance.mpp");
Шаг 3. Выполните итерацию по назначению ресурсов
Просмотрите все назначения ресурсов в проекте, чтобы получить доступ к сведениям о каждом назначении.
for (ResourceAssignment ra : project.getResourceAssignments()) {
// Выполнение операций над каждым назначением ресурса
}
Шаг 4. Подсчитайте процент выполнения работ.
Получите процент выполнения работы для каждого назначения ресурсов с помощью Aspose.Tasks.
for (ResourceAssignment ra : project.getResourceAssignments()) {
System.out.println(ra.get(Asn.PERCENT_WORK_COMPLETE).toString());
}
Заключение
Следуя этим простым шагам, вы сможете легко рассчитать проценты для назначения ресурсов в Aspose.Tasks для Java, оптимизируя рабочий процесс управления проектами и обеспечивая оптимальное использование ресурсов.
Часто задаваемые вопросы
Вопрос: Может ли Aspose.Tasks обрабатывать сложные структуры проектов?
О: Да, Aspose.Tasks поддерживает легкую обработку сложных структур проектов, позволяя вам управлять проектами любого масштаба.
Вопрос: Подходит ли Aspose.Tasks для управления проектами на уровне предприятия?
Ответ: Конечно, Aspose.Tasks предлагает надежные функции, предназначенные для управления проектами на уровне предприятия, включая распределение ресурсов, планирование и отчетность.
Вопрос: Могу ли я интегрировать Aspose.Tasks с другими библиотеками Java?
О: Конечно, Aspose.Tasks можно легко интегрировать с другими библиотеками Java, чтобы расширить ваши возможности управления проектами.
Вопрос: Предоставляет ли Aspose.Tasks поддержку клиентов?
О: Да, Aspose.Tasks предлагает специальную поддержку клиентов через свой форум. Вы можете найти помощьздесь.
Вопрос: Доступна ли бесплатная пробная версия Aspose.Tasks?
О: Да, вы можете изучить Aspose.Tasks, воспользовавшись бесплатной пробной версией.здесь.